Recognition of Statistics as a Key Discipline in India
y During the 1920s and until the mid-1930s, all or nearly all the
statistical work done in India, was done single-handedly by Prof.
Mahalanobis.
y The early statistical studies included analyses of data on stature of
Anglo-Indians, meteorological data, rainfall data, data on soil
conditions, etc.
y Some of the findings of these early studies were of great impact in
the control of floods, development of agriculture, etc., and led to the
recognition of Statistics as a key discipline.
4
The Statistical Mind
y Mahalanobis' influence was so pervasive that students of Physics
began to take interest in Statistics. Several talented young scholars
including J.M. Sengupta, H.C. Sinha, R.C. Bose, S.N. Roy,
K.R. Nair, K. Kishen and C.R. Rao, joined to form an active
group of statisticians.
y Mahalanobis continued to be the nucleus. Theoretical
research in Statistics began to flourish in the Institute. Research on
large scale sample surveys won Mahalanobis a Fellowship of the
Royal Society. Design and analysis of agricultural experiments
also bloomed and led to some international contacts, notably with
Sir Ronald A. Fisher.

Salt in statistics……..
There were communal riots in Delhi in 1947 immediately after
India achieved independence.
A large number of people of a minority community took refuge
in the Red Fort which is a protected area
The Government had the responsibility to feed these refugees
12
Salt in statistics……..
Then the problem before the experts was
to estimate the number of persons inside a given area
without any prior information about the order of magnitude of
the number,
without having any opportunity to look at the concentrations of
persons inside the area and without using any known
sampling techniques for estimation or census methods.
13
Salt in statistics……..
Available data:
Bills submitted by the contractors to the government, which
gave the quantities of various commodities such as rice,
pulses and salt purchased by them to feed the refugees.
14
Salt in statistics……..
Let R, P and S represent the quantities of rice, pulses and salt
used per day to feed all the refugees.
From consumption surveys, the per capita requirements of
these commodities are known, say, r, p and s respectively.
Then R/r, P/p and S/s would provide parallel (equally valid)
estimates of the same number of persons.
15
Salt in statistics……..
It was found that
S/s had the smallest value and
R/r, the largest value indicating that the quantity of rice,
which is the most expensive commodity compared to salt, was
probably exaggerated.
The estimate S/s was proposed by the statisticians for the
number of refugees in the Red Fort.
